An Italian experiment has unveiled evidence that fundamental particles known as neutrinos can travel faster than light.

Particles Found to Travel Faster than Speed of Light

Other researchers are cautious about the result, but if it stands further scrutiny, the finding would overturn the most fundamental rule of modern physics—that nothing travels faster than 299,792,458 meters per second. The experiment is called OPERA (Oscillation Project with Emulsion-tRacking Apparatus), and lies 1,400 meters underground in the Gran Sasso National Laboratory in Italy. It is designed to study a beam of neutrinos coming from CERN, Europe's premier high-energy physics laboratory located 730 kilometers away near Geneva, Switzerland. Neutrinos are fundamental particles that are electrically neutral, rarely interact with other matter, and have a vanishingly small mass. Standard Model. Solar Energy. Transducer Software. Space. By Robert Sanders, Media Relations | 13 November 2008 BERKELEY — After eight years and repeated photographs of a nearby star in hopes of finding planets, University of California, Berkeley, astronomer Paul Kalas finally has his prize: the first visible-light snapshots of a planet outside our solar system.

UC Berkeley Press Release

This 2006 Hubble Space Telescope optical image shows the belt of dust and debris (bright oval) surrounding the star Fomalhaut and the planet (inset) that orbits the star every 872 years and sculpts the inner edge of the belt. A coronagraph (center) on the Advanced Camera for Surveys blocks out the light of the star, which is 100 million times brighter than the planet.

Cosmic race ends in a tie

A race between two energetic photons that began more than 7 billion years ago and spanned half the cosmos has ended in a virtual dead heat. The result, if it stands up to scrutiny, would tighten the limits, suggested by some theories, on how ‘lumpy’ space-time can be. The work, to be presented on 11 January at the 219th meeting of the American Astronomical Society in Austin, Texas, by Robert Nemiroff of the Michigan Technological University in Houghton and his colleagues1, relies on an analysis of a short-lived, powerful stellar explosion known as a γ-ray burst that was recorded by NASA's Fermi Gamma-ray Space Telescope in May 2009 and dubbed GRB 090510A. The study focused on two photons, one with an energy of 25 gigaelectronvolts (GeV) and another of about 1.5 GeV, which were separated by just 0.00136 seconds. Faster-than-light neutrino claim bolstered - physics-math - 23 September 2011

The result is conceptually simple: neutrinos travelling from a particle accelerator at CERN in Switzerland arrived 60 nanoseconds too early at a detector in the Gran Sasso cavern in Italy. And it relies on three conceptually simple measurements, explained Dario Autiero of the Institute of Nuclear Physics in Lyon: the distance between the labs, the time the neutrinos left Switzerland, and the time they arrived in Italy. Laser cooling of semiconductor membranes opens doors for quantum computing [Date: 2012-01-25] By innovatively combining two research fields - quantum physics and nanophysics - EU-funded Danish researchers have discovered a new method for laser cooling semiconductor membranes.

News : FP7 News : Laser cooling of semiconductor membranes opens doors for quantum computing

Semiconductors are vital components in many electronic goods such as solar cells and light-emitting diodes (LEDs), and it is important to be able to cool these components for the future development of quantum computers and ultrasensitive sensors.
